Garda Robert McCallion honoured on the 16th anniversary of his passing

TODAY marks the 16th anniversary of the passing of Garda Robert McCallion.

Garda McCallion, originally from Swinford, Co Mayo was serving in Letterkenny when he tragically lost his life in the line of duty.

On the morning of March 26, 2009, Garda McCallion and two other colleagues responded to a call at Tara Court in Letterkenny.

While dealing with the situation, the gardaí observed a car approaching at speed.

Garda McCallion was struck by the vehicle and sustained serious injuries.

He was conveyed to Beaumont Hospital in Dublin where, on April 7, 2009, he succumbed to his injuries.

Born on August 9, 1979, Garda McCallion worked with Corrib Oil before joining An Garda Síochána on February 7, 2005.

Honouring a family legacy, he followed in the footsteps of his father, brother, uncles, and cousin, who all served in An Garda Síochána.

Paying tribute to their late colleague on his 16th anniversary, An Garda Síochána Donegal said Garda McCallion is never far from the thoughts of all those who had the pleasure of working with him.

“May Robbie’s gentle soul rest in peace,” a spokesperson said.
